Sporting Kansas City Forward Johnny Russell Voted Alcatel MLS Player of the Week
NEW YORK
(Tuesday, April 24, 2018)
– Sporting Kansas City forward Johnny Russell was voted the Alcatel Major League Soccer Player of the Week by the North American Soccer Reporters (NASR) for the eighth week of the 2018 MLS season.
Sporting KC extended its season-best unbeaten streak to seven matches with a 6-0 victory over Vancouver Whitecaps FC on Friday, with Russell scoring a hat trick in front of the home crowd. Over eight starts this season, the 28-year-old Russell ranks tied for second in the league with five goals scored to go along with his two assists. SKC sits atop the Western Conference and is tied for the most points in the league with a 5-1-2 overall record (17 points).
The Scotland National Team member gave Sporting KC an early advantage in the 10
th
minute. Receiving a pass from Roger Espinoza at the top of the box, Russell launched a right-footed shot between the defender’s legs to the left side of goal to beat goalkeeper Stefan Marinovic far post (
Watch Goal
). Russell would give SKC a 2-0 lead in the 16
th
minute with an impressive run into the box, outmaneuvering a defender with a myriad of moves before beating the keeper with a right-footed shot that snuck inside the near post (
Watch Goal
).
Russell capped a career day with his third goal in the 48
th
minute to give SKC a 4-0 advantage. Matt Besler sent a pass into the right side of the box, with Russell collecting the ball along the goal line and sending a chip shot over Marinovic into the left side of the net (
Watch Goal
). Sporting KC would then score two more goals in the second half to complete the 6-0 victory.
Sporting Kansas City returns to action on Saturday, April 28 to face the New England Revolution at Gillette Stadium (7:30 p.m. ET, ESPN+).
The Alcatel MLS Player of the Week is chosen each week of the regular season by members of the North American Soccer Reporters. The organization includes print, television, radio and online journalists who cover domestic men's soccer in the United States and Canada. Learn more about the NASR and apply to join at
